Dubbed the “world’s #1 AI learning assistant,” Mindgrasp instantly creates notes, summaries, flashcards, quizzes, and answers questions from any document, YouTube video, Zoom meeting, webinar recording, podcast, and more.
The tool can “read for you” and can “handle” all kinds of documents, including books, essays, resumes, research articles, legal case files, etc. It can just as easily “watch for you,” which can come in handy when you don’t have time to join a webinar or don’t want to watch an hour-long video to get the key findings.
Once it “digests” the content, Mindgrasp can help you clarify and understand the material. Simply ask the AI assistant for clarifications on all kinds of subjects. It’s like your “study buddy” that can keep up with every move you make online thanks to the provided Chrome extension.
Mindgrasp is available in more than 10 languages and is already being used by over 100,000 students, as well as researchers and professionals (numbers from September 2023). The students, in case you wonder, come from such universities as Stanford, Princeton, MIT, The Ohio State University, and the University of Maryland.

What are the key features? ✨
- Read for you: Mindgrasp lets you upload books, essays, resumes, research articles, legal case files, etc. It can handle PDFs, DOCX, and PowerPoint files, as well as links to web pages:
- Watch for you: Similarly, it can take your place when the assignment requires you to watch a webinar or a long video. Let Mindgrasp do the work for you and ask it for notes afterward. It can handle MP3 and MP4 files, as well as videos hosted on YouTube and Vimeo.
- AI assistant: Once Mindgrasp "digests" the content, you can ask it for notes or chat with the assistant to get answers to any questions you may have. It will help you understand and clarify key concepts. In a way, Mindgrasp is like your study buddy.
- Chrome extension: Mindgrasp provides a neat Chrome extension that lets you bring their AI assistant all around the web and get instant answers and information whenever you need them.
